Pr. 6 Dialogue in the Dark

In Dialogue in the Dark, the Primary 6 girls “saw” the world of the visually impaired through simulated everyday activities in total darkness. Simple tasks like walking through a park and crossing a street became ‘real’ challenges for them. This event aims to create awareness of the world of the blind by immersing sighted people in it and letting them experience it first hand, with the help from a guide who is visually impaired. The students found the experience exciting and inspiring. They learnt what an important role the other senses played for the visually impaired and felt greater empathy and respect for them.
